31Jul

Kuidas ma saan jälgida muudatusi, mida programmi installija teeb?

Mis täpselt on , need installiprogrammid teevad edenemisriba külge? Kui soovite hoolega silma peal hoida, on teil vaja õigeid tööriistu.

Tänane küsimus &Vastuse seanss on meile viisakalt SuperUseriga - Q & A veebisaitide kogukonna juhtimisgrupi Stack Exchange osakond.

Küsimus

SuperUser-lugeja Gregory Moussat soovib teada, mis paigaldaja fassaadi taga läheb:

Ma tahan teada, mida mõned installijad teevad: peamiselt milliseid faile, kaustu ja registri sissekandeid nad lisavad, eemaldavad või muudavad.

Paljud "professionaalsed" programmid on nii halvasti dokumenteeritud, et on raske leida õiget moodust nende konfigureerimiseks, nende värskendamiseks jms.

InstallRite on programm, mis suudab teha "hetktõmmise" enne ja pärast programmi installimistja siis võrrelda pilte. See võimaldab teil teada, mis on tehtud ja isegi kohandatud desinstalliprogrammi loomiseks. Kahjuks tundub, et InstallRite ei toimi enam ja seda pole alates 2008. aastast uuendatud.

Milline tööriist asendab InstallRite'i?

Vastus

Kaustaja Synetech pakub alternatiivset võimalust:

On mitmeid ja mul on testitud vähemalt 10-12, kuid eelistan ja soovitan seda ZSoft Uninstallerit. See on tasuta ja on hea leida vahet, ilma et teid hämmastaksite võõraste segadustega, nagu enamik neist programmidest, isegi kommertseesmärgid.

Kasutan ka PC Magazine'i InCtrl 5-d, mis on väga hea( piisav Microsofti heakskiidu saamiseks), kuid mitu aastat tagasi peatasid nad oma programmid tasuta, kuid kuna see oli vaba, on veel palju eksemplare( kahjuks mittenii et uuema InCtrl X-ga.)

Kui olete huvitatud InCtrl-i( InCtrl X) uuendatud koopia saamisest, käivitate see $ 8-st. Lisateavet InCtrl X kohta leiate siit.

Teine kaasautor Prahlad Yeri pakub mõningaid soovitusi selle kohta, kuidas rakendust käsitsi uurida:

Mida paigaldaja tõesti üksikasjalikult ei saa teada, välja arvatud ehk pöördprojekteerimisel oma binaarsed juhised. Siin on mõned märksõnad, mida saate kontrollida:

  1. Kontrollige programmifailide kataloogis rakenduste kaustu. Tavaliselt on sisestatud inC: \ Program Files \ AppXYZ.
  2. Sarnaselt kontrollige ka süsteemikaustu( C: \ Windows \ System32).Teie rakendus oleks võinud paigutada raamatukogud( DLL /OCX/ TLBd) siin.
  3. Käivitage CCleaner, et näha, kas ta on loonud registri sissekanded. CCleaner näitab ka teisi muudatusi, mida rakendus oleks võinud teha, näiteks MIME tüübi registreerimine jne.
  4. Ärge unustage kontrollima. NET GAC( Global Assembly Cache).See sisaldab kõiki. NET-komplekte, mida teie rakendus oleks teie arvutisse registreerinud. Tavaliselt on see kaust C: \ windows \ assembly
  5. Ilmne( kuid mõnikord selge on tähelepanuta jäetud!):
    • menüü Start ja töölaua otseteed
    • failid C: \ users \ USER-NAME \ Rakendusandmetes( CCleaner näitab neid)
    • sissekanded käivitusmenüüst ja boot.ini( nende kontrollimiseks käsku msconfig)

Rakenduse hetktõmmiste kontrollimisel ja failide käsitsi kontrollimisel on kõik teie alused kaetud. Siin saate tutvuda SuperUseri täieliku aruteluga. Kas soovite loendisse lisamiseks kasutada tööriista või tehnikat? Helistage kommentaarides.